I'm confused (nothing new!:confused:). Cruising on Carnival Miracle in October; thought I read on somewhere that breakfast and lunch were no longer being served in the DR. Does the Comedy Brunch replace that, or did someone post the wrong info? (or did I imagine it?:rolleyes:).

 

I know in the past the DR would usually be open only on sea days, but is that still the case or has the policy changed? Comments from recent cruisers will be appreciated. Thanks.

Got an answer on another thread from an experienced cruiser. Apparently it depends on the ship. We're doing Carnival Miracle which only has one DR, therefore they offer the Comedy Brunch until 1PM or so, and maybe breakfast and lunch in the DR on sea days (or did she say port days?:rolleyes:)

 

Anyways, it doesn't apply if the ship has 2 DR's; one will be Comedy Brunch, one will be normal lunch service.
